Official Go implementation of the Ethereum protocol
You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
Felix Lange
2c37142d2f
cmd/devp2p, p2p: dial using node iterator, discovery crawler (#20132)
* p2p/enode: add Iterator and associated utilities
* p2p/discover: add RandomNodes iterator
* p2p: dial using iterator
* cmd/devp2p: add discv4 crawler
* cmd/devp2p: WIP nodeset filter
* cmd/devp2p: fixup lesFilter
* core/forkid: add NewStaticFilter
* cmd/devp2p: make -eth-network filter actually work
* cmd/devp2p: improve crawl timestamp handling
* cmd/devp2p: fix typo
* p2p/enode: fix comment typos
* p2p/discover: fix comment typos
* p2p/discover: rename lookup.next to 'advance'
* p2p: lower discovery mixer timeout
* p2p/enode: implement dynamic FairMix timeouts
* cmd/devp2p: add ropsten support in -eth-network filter
* cmd/devp2p: tweak crawler log message
|
5 years ago |
.. |
discover
|
cmd/devp2p, p2p: dial using node iterator, discovery crawler (#20132)
|
5 years ago |
discv5
|
p2p/enode, p2p/discv5: fix URL parsing test for go 1.12.8 (#19963)
|
5 years ago |
dnsdisc
|
p2p/dnsdisc: update to latest EIP-1459 spec (#20168)
|
5 years ago |
enode
|
cmd/devp2p, p2p: dial using node iterator, discovery crawler (#20132)
|
5 years ago |
enr
|
core/forkid: implement the forkid EIP, announce via ENR (#19738)
|
5 years ago |
nat
|
p2p, p2p/discover: add signed ENR generation (#17753)
|
6 years ago |
netutil
|
all: update author list and licenses
|
5 years ago |
simulations
|
p2p/simulations: add node properties support and utility functions (#20060)
|
5 years ago |
testing
|
all: update author list and licenses
|
5 years ago |
dial.go
|
cmd/devp2p, p2p: dial using node iterator, discovery crawler (#20132)
|
5 years ago |
dial_test.go
|
cmd/devp2p, p2p: dial using node iterator, discovery crawler (#20132)
|
5 years ago |
message.go
|
p2p: measure subprotocol bandwidth usage
|
5 years ago |
message_test.go
|
all: fix go vet warnings
|
9 years ago |
metrics.go
|
core, metrics, p2p: switch some invalid counters to gauges
|
5 years ago |
peer.go
|
p2p: measure subprotocol bandwidth usage
|
5 years ago |
peer_error.go
|
p2p: fix some golint warnings (#16577)
|
7 years ago |
peer_test.go
|
p2p: enforce connection retry limit on server side (#19684)
|
6 years ago |
protocol.go
|
cmd/devp2p, p2p: dial using node iterator, discovery crawler (#20132)
|
5 years ago |
rlpx.go
|
p2p: measure subprotocol bandwidth usage
|
5 years ago |
rlpx_test.go
|
p2p: remove useless parameter (#19433)
|
6 years ago |
server.go
|
cmd/devp2p, p2p: dial using node iterator, discovery crawler (#20132)
|
5 years ago |
server_test.go
|
cmd/devp2p, p2p: dial using node iterator, discovery crawler (#20132)
|
5 years ago |
util.go
|
p2p: enforce connection retry limit on server side (#19684)
|
6 years ago |
util_test.go
|
p2p: enforce connection retry limit on server side (#19684)
|
6 years ago |